Conversely, young Indonesians are growing up in a globalized, hyper-connected world. They are exposed to Western and global media that normalize dating, individuality, and personal autonomy. This cultural friction creates a environment where teenagers live double lives—maintaining a traditional, compliant facade for their families while exploring modern relationship dynamics in hidden digital spaces.
